Every TM promo comes with two separate things: the data or minutes you paid for, and a countdown clock that decides how long you get to use them. The moment the clock hits zero, whatever is left disappears — even if there are gigabytes sitting unused. TM's fix is called extending: it lets you buy one more day of validity for a small fee instead of losing everything and paying for a brand-new promo.

What Extending Your Load Does

TM promos run on two tracks: the amount of data, calls, or texts you bought, and how many days you can use them. Extending only touches the second track — it buys one more day, nothing else.

On EasySurf promos, only your main open-access data carries over. The app bundle freebies (FunALIW, FunACHIEVE) still expire on the original schedule — this is why bundle apps can stop working even after a successful extend.

What You Need Before You Extend

  • At least ₱5 of regular load — promo balance or Utang Load will not work
  • Your current promo must still be active (once TM sends the expiration notice, the window closes)
  • The promo must support extension — most popular ones do, but some limited-time offers do not
Extending keeps your remaining balance and costs only ₱5. Re-registering wipes your current balance and charges the full promo price again. If you still have data left and only need a few more hours, extending is almost always cheaper.

How to Extend Using the EXTEND Code

This is the original method and still works for call, text, and combo promos in 2026.

  1. 1Open your messaging app and start a new message
  2. 2Type EXTEND in capital letters
  3. 3Send it to 8080
  4. 4Wait for the confirmation SMS with your new validity date

TM deducts ₱5 only after the extension goes through, not when you send the text. Plain EXTEND is most reliable when you have only one active promo — with several running, it may extend whichever is closest to expiring, which is why data promos use a separate code.

How to Extend EasySurf With EZ EXTEND

EasySurf — including EZ50, EZ70, and similar tiers — uses a dedicated keyword so the system knows you mean your data promo. Type EZ EXTEND (with a space) and send to 8080; wait for the confirmation that your EasySurf data is valid for another 24 hours.

FREE Extend OffersTM occasionally runs campaigns giving one free extension day on select promos (commonly EasySURF50 Doble Data). Text FREE EXTEND to 8080 before expiry to add 24 hours to your open-access data at no cost — once per subscription, main data only, and only the first EasySurf subscription qualifies.

Extend via USSD or GlobeOne

USSD: dial *143# → select Combo or EasySURF → choose Extend → confirm the ₱5 charge. This works even when SMS fails during congestion. GlobeOne: open the app, tap your active promo, look for the Extend / Get More Time button — it deducts ₱5 automatically and pushes your expiry forward one day.

The safest window is 1–2 hours before your promo expires. Sending it right after expiration won't work (the promo is gone), and sending it two days early also fails (there's nothing to extend yet). Call and text promos can be extended up to 365 times a year.

What Happens If You Don't Extend in Time

The moment your promo expires without an extension, TM switches your line to Regular Browsing mode. Any leftover gigabytes — even several unused GBs — are deleted permanently. Worse, Regular Browsing charges your regular load at standard per-KB rates, which drains your balance far faster than any promo. Setting a reminder an hour before expiry avoids both the lost data and the surprise deductions.
